Catholic Charities Maine SEARCH (Seek Elderly Alone, Renew Courage & Hope) Program is seeking a part-time RSVP/SEARCH Project Coordinator for Somerset County. The mission of the SEARCH Program is to enable vulnerable seniors to remain independent and create a long-term support system to meet their needs. We recruit and train volunteers to provide companionship support services and transportation assistance to help seniors remain independent in their own homes. RSVP is our Retired Senior Volunteer Program, that is an AmeriCorps senior’s project that supports our SEARCH program clients and two area food pantries. Definition: The Project Coordinator is the person responsible for carrying out the day-to-day implementation of the program site. We are looking for someone with knowledge of community organizations and resources that support the senior population in the 9 towns in southern Somerset County that we are currently serving. Experience in public speaking a plus. Experience in working with the elderly population and volunteers is preferred. Experience and knowledge in working with Microsoft outlook, excel, SharePoint, and word preferred. There will be local travel in the program's service areas. This position is 22 hours per week, based on our RSVP/SEARCH project work in Somerset County. It includes 20 hours weekly for RSVP project work, and 2 hours weekly for our SEARCH program work.
